Coach Boeheim Quotes
Georgia Tech at Syracuse
Dec. 21, 2002
Carrier Dome, Syracuse, N.Y.
"We played as well defensively as we’ve played in a long time. We handled their pressure. Last year their pressure killed us. I don’t know how many million turnovers we had down there last year and we didn’t turn it over hardly at all tonight. Once we got that first stage going Hakim (Warrick) got us going and then Carmelo (Anthony) got it going and hit a couple."
On Carmelo Anthony:
"He’s like all good players. Once they miss a couple, they don’t worry about it. They think they are going to make the next one."
On Gerry McNamara:
He’s one of the best freshman in the country, I think. He came out with a mindset. He is a big game player. He’s been the guy for four years, he’s used to making plays. He’s had to scale back his game from what he’s used to. Tonight I thought he didn’t scale anything back. He came out aggressive and I thought people looked for him and started to find him better."
On SU's rebounding:
"We rebounded pretty well in the first half. I think outside of Bosh, they go with a pretty small team. They’re pretty small. We felt coming in we had to get on the boards and we did get there early and got a couple. We did a pretty good job on our defensive boards. Better than normal."
